The worldwide success of

 HAMEG

´s

 HM205 

and

 HM305 

has led to the

introduction of the new microprocessor controlled

 HM407 

Analog/Digital

oscilloscope. This instrument offers much more performance and specifications
over its predecessores. The

 HM407 

incorporates a

 microprocessor-based 

system

that extensively automates operation. The majority of signals can be displayed by
simply pressing the “Autoset“ button. A

 “Save/Recall“ 

function is available for

storing frequently used setup parameters.

The increased maximum sampling rate of

 100MS/s 

now allows to capture a

10MHz 

signal in “Single“ mode with

 10 samples 

(dots) per period. The

 automatic

Dot-Join 

function provides linear connections between the captured points,

ensuring that all digitized signals are displayed without gaps. New features are the

two reference memories

, allowing their contents to be compared with the live

signal at any time. Cursors can be activated for waveform measurements. All
important parameter settings are displayed on the CRT screen. The

 built-in RS232-

Interface 

enables remote control operation and signal processing via a PC.

Unique in its price range is also the analog section of the

 HM407. 

The increased

bandwidth of

 40MHz 

(-3dB) allows the stable display of signals up to 

100MHz

. As

always, the

 Component Tester 

with one-button control is a standard feature in

the

 HM407

. This is also true for the switchable 

1kHz/1MHz Calibrator 

which

permits you to check the transient characteristics from probe tip to the screen at
any time.

All in all, the new

 HM407 

presents itself as a practical hands-on oscilloscope for

today’s progressive measurement  requirements offering a price/performance ra-
tio that sets new standards world-wide.
